Montana Geothermal Sites: Landusky
SUMMARY INFORMATION:
Location:   N 47.8981
W 108.6715
Nearest town:  8.5 MI S HAYS, South edge of Little Rocky Mountains
County: PHILLIPS
Depth: Springs
Temperature:  69° F
Flow:  628 gpm
TDS: 1367 (mg/L)
Site ID:   MGEOT072

CHEMISTRY (ppm, mg/L)
Site name: LANDUSKY
Temp: 20º C
TDS: 1367
pH: 7.88
Sodium: 35.2
Potassium: 9.1
Calcium: 251
Magnesium: 87
Iron: 0.01
SiO2: 15
Sulfate: 871
Chloride: 13.7
Fluoride: 1.4

The Little Rockies area contains considerable warm water (24 C) derived from the Madison Group, at surface or shallow depths. Drilling in the surrounding area may increase the available flow to 100,000 -250,000 L/min (Sonderegger & Bergantino, 1981).
